Output afd3a4527c32f9afa845c18f08bd30f4e38f170e2ded1aa89b1ca9ebbc3452db:0

value
18741243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bf67db31728f906b8164fe8b7aeb0fd31ee9f9 OP_EQUAL
address
3CWtxHCaVUeemCeUaSf5xBNgw4K2aLHuBS
transaction
afd3a4527c32f9afa845c18f08bd30f4e38f170e2ded1aa89b1ca9ebbc3452db
confirmations
333673
spent
true